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Add salt to taste and cook the whole grain rigatoni pasta according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
In a large skillet, heat the extra virgin ol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ic, sautΓ©ing until the onion is translucent, about 5 minutes.
Add the diced tomatoes and tomato paste to the skillet. Stir well to combine and bring to a simmer.
Season the sauce with dried oregano, dried basil, and red pepper flakes. Add salt and ground black pepper to taste. Allow the sauce to simmer gently for 10-15 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Stir in the fresh spinach and cook until wilted, about 3 minutes.
Combine the cooked rigatoni with the tomato sauce and toss to coat the pasta evenly.
Divide the pasta among plates and sprinkle each serving with 1 tablespoon of grated Parmesan cheese.
Garnish with fresh basil leaves and serve immediately.
